    That would be one heck of a good fight Kostya vs Corrales all belts up on the line! Kostya might be ok with his punching power but if it isn't enough it will be hard to keep Diego at bay. Once Corrales knows you can't hurt him your in big trouble. Corrales is the kind of fighter you have to stay on top of can't even let him breath if you can stay on him. He has a heck of a left hook and he landed it a lot on Saturday night and with power. Its just that Castillo was taking the shots well at first than they started making him go backwards so there effect took there toll on Castillo later in there fight. Its fair to say that Corrales and Castillo both were pretty beat up by the time they went into the beginning of the 10th round! ! !
